That would be your man. For a Manchester broadside edition of the 1850s, see  Bodleian Library Broadside Ballads:

I should like to be a policeman

The corrupt "new policeman" (frequently characterised, particularly in the USA, as a venal Irishman) was a standing joke through most of the 19th century. The broadside song quoted earlier (not really related to the subject of this thread, but made on the same lines) is, I think, an Americanisation of an English music hall piece. Copies also at Bodleian.
